As an Accounting Technician, you will:
· Lead compilation and tax engagements for clients in a wide variety of sectors but with a heavy emphasis on agriculture and fisheries.
· Collaborate with team members and partners to identify issues and solve discrepancies
· Communicate directly with clients to obtain information, clarify issues, and discuss key matters
· Communicate with government agencies regarding information requests, assessment notices, and other correspondence
· Communicate and liaise with tax authorities and clients with matters concerning tax audits, appeals and tax positions.
· Contribute to continuous improvement in processes and documentation.
· Support client-facing Account Managers with accurate, timely file work
What You Bring:
Must Haves
· Minimum 3 years of public practice experience (exceptions made for top candidates)
· Strong accounting knowledge + experience in corporate and personal tax prep
· Familiarity with CaseWare, iFirm TaxPrep or equivalent, QuickBooks Online/Desktop
· Excellent client communication and deadline management skills
Nice-to-Haves
· Accounting diploma, degree, or equivalent experience
· Experience with agricultural/fisheries clients
· Knowledge of farm and fisheries production practices
· Comfortable working in a fast-paced, fully digital environment
· Willingness to learn and leverage AI tools

Performance metrics
Each team member at ATMOS is encouraged to participate in setting out their own performance metrics based on their abilities and contributions. Below are examples of performance metrics on which you will be measured for:
- Accuracy, measured by errors in accounting and tax returns – or lack thereof;
- Timeliness, measured by on-time deliverables;
- Knowledge, measured by the number of queries successfully and accurately answered in ways that clients could easily understand and implement
- Efficiency, measured by time spent on specific projects and by the ratio of time spent on client work compared to administrative tasks;
- Client satisfaction, measured by client surveys and referrals;
- Issue identification, measured by new services delivered or solutions presented.
